PONDI CRIES OUT AS BURUTU FEDERAL CONSTITUENCY IN MASSIVE FLOOD DEVASTATION

~High Chief Seikam
Abuja

The member representing Burutu federal consultancy in the House of Representatives Hon. Julius G Pondi decries that flood has taken over most towns and villages in his constituency.
In a statement sent to news men and a copy was sent to Creek News.

Hon Pondi states that “In the past four weeks, Burutu Federal Constituency and adjoining local government areas have been under massive flooding following days of unending rains and pounding ocean wave surges that has led to increase in water level. In their wake, several towns and villages have succumbed to these natural discomfort making several houses uninhabitable and other valuables devastated. Thousands of people including the aged, the sick and children have been displaced from their homes, and schools made to shut down for weeks.
Some of the most affected are Burutu Township, and several towns and villages in the local government  area, while neighboring local government are also victims.

Ayakoromo community and it's secondary school, the Ayakoromo Grammar School are not spared. Bolou Ndoro Community, Tuomo, Torugbene, Ojobo, Tamigbe, Obotebe, Gbekobu, Akparemo gbene, Ogbeingbene, Ofenibeinghan (Okrika) and many others are now under flood waters. Also very worrisome now is the fact that thousands of residents (my constituents) taking refuge in alternative places waiting for the intervention of the federal and state authorities. “

He further stated that “The flooding has in recent times become an annual irritation, and in spite of my outcries for help both at plenary sessions of the house of representatives and privately with stakeholders to seek the aid of federal authorities, nothing is usually done for my people to ameliorate the devastation, even as I often note that similar flooding in other parts of the country are often promptly and swiftly attended to with public messages from state actors expressing their empathy for victims and the assurances of quick and sweeping supplies of aids. The same should be done for my people in the spirit of fairness, equity and public good.”
